Output dab657e977f13ace61e2266742edb6c6481e89d989a5d56c8cbadbc22dd8903e:1

value
28119030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f74a30e73f7280c5ab72576975a97b2bfb4e5916 OP_EQUAL
address
3QEZhosQN1KSRWVeUUU3WNGG3ve9Z4Pce6
transaction
dab657e977f13ace61e2266742edb6c6481e89d989a5d56c8cbadbc22dd8903e
spent
true